The large cardamom market continues to exhibit a cautious and somewhat fatigued mood. Despite previous periods of heightened activity, prices have softened over the last month and a half as both domestic and export demand remain subdued. Industry participants report that, while there have been occasional short-lived recoveries in price, a combination of moderate buying interest and steady arrivals from major producing regions is keeping prices range-bound.
The absence of any notable shortage in the market, coupled with buyers purchasing only to meet immediate requirements, has prevented any sustained rallies. Current supply is described as stable, and while some quality variation exists, it has not significantly affected overall availability. Unless there is a notable increase in export demand or an unexpected contraction in supply, market sentiment remains neutral to slightly negative for the near term. The prevailing view among traders and stakeholders is that only a substantial shift in either demand or supply dynamics will break the current inertia and send prices decisively upward. For now, the market’s tone is best described as flat, with little expectation for immediate gains in large cardamom pricing.

🌍 Supply & Demand
- Supply: Arrivals from North-Eastern India continue at a steady pace. No significant shortages have been reported, although there is some minor quality variation.
- Demand: Domestic consumption is steady but not robust. Export demand remains selective and sporadic, limited to buyers’ immediate needs.
- Market participants highlight that the cautious approach by buyers is preventing price rallies, keeping the tone soft.
📊 Fundamentals
- Current trend: Overall market prices are under pressure, with little sign of imminent recovery.
- Inventory: Adequate stocks and steady arrivals support a comfortable supply position.
- Speculative activity: Minimal, with traders holding off on bulk purchases.
🌦️ Weather Outlook & Crop Impact
- Weather conditions in major cardamom-producing regions of North-East India remain broadly favorable.
- No significant climatic disruptions reported; as a result, crop arrivals are steady and quality largely maintained.
- Continued normal weather patterns are expected to support adequate supply in the coming weeks.
🌐 Global Production & Stocks
- India remains the primary exporter, with significant shares from North-Eastern states.
- Demand from traditional importing countries (Middle East, EU) remains cautious.
- Export volumes have not exhibited substantial growth, contributing to the muted price environment.
